Marymount Manhattan College is a private nonprofit, baccalaureate institution in New York. This report summarizes admissions activity from 2025 federal data.

Acceptance rate

82.6%

SAT Evidence-Based Reading & Writing (25th-75th percentile)

SAT Evidence-Based Reading & Writing (25th-75th percentile) Range from 200 to 800; 25-75 band 585-673. 200 800 25-75 percentile

SAT Math (25th-75th percentile)

SAT Math (25th-75th percentile) Range from 200 to 800; 25-75 band 520-650. 200 800 25-75 percentile

ACT composite range (admitted students)

ACT composite range (admitted students) Range from 1 to 36; 25-75 band 24-27. 1 36 25-75 percentile

Race / ethnicity of undergraduates

Race / ethnicity of undergraduates Stacked bar: White 42.4%, Unknown 20.5%, Hispanic 17.9%, Black 9.2%, Two or more 4.6%, Non-resident 2.9%, Asian 2.3%, Native 0.2%, Pacific Islander 0.1%. 42.4% 20.5% 17.9% 9.2% White 42.4% Unknown 20.5% Hispanic 17.9% Black 9.2% Two or more 4.6% Non-resident 2.9% Asian 2.3% Native 0.2% Pacific Islander 0.1%
